Hello

- do tests in item form (just in case you have caching ON)

have added any spaces in the language file ?
e.g.
this is wrong:
SOMENAME ="test"

it should be:
SOMENAME="test"

Hello

also note that Joomla has different files for frontend and backend
- make sure you languaga overrides for both frontend and backend
(for site and for administrator)
